This book is a journey of mine. I write poetry to help me to better deal with PTSD. These are poems that come from the experiences of my daily life. I write about everything from love to war time memories.

Justin Wright was born in Rock Rapids, Iowa. When he was a kid he always dreamed of being a writer and joining the Marines. He ran into some trouble when he was young and found himself in and out of juvenile detention facilities. He graduated high school in May of 2004. He joined the Marine Corps when he was 18. He served 6 years 8 months of Honorable Service in the Marines and completed 2 tours of duty in Iraq before being Medically Retired for Post Traumatic Stress Disorder and Bipolar Disorder. He received a Service Dog (Bella) for his problems with PTSD, anxiety, and panic attacks. He is now happily engaged to a beautiful Annette Thatcher. He has a step daughter Jayden and daughter Trinity. They now live in Maine. Life after the Corps is interesting to say the least. Learning to be a civilian is an everyday struggle. One that he takes to heart. He wishes he could have been able to have stayed in the Marines. He loved it. It was the kind of life you would only dream about as a boy.
